Lionel pw-50

50 GANG CAR RIGHT HAND HORN

 

Motorized. Self-powered section gang car. Unpainted orange shell. One figure rotates when car contacts bumper and changes direction. Ornamental horn. Blue bumpers. A number of variations exist due to the long production run. Built from 1954 until 1964. Horn on the right side. The three original figures have painted faces. The one thing most collectors look for on a gang car is if it has all of the three very tiny (1/32") handles located on the control panel next to one of the hands. They usually have one or all handles broken off (these have nothing to do with the operation of the car, and cars work perfectly even if the handles are broken off).
